What is the required preparation before digging fence post holes?
State law requires calling 811 (Dig Safely New York) at least two full business days before excavation. Hitting a buried utility line in De Peyster Center is a major liability event with fines and repair costs. A professional crew manages this call and all related permit office paperwork for the client.

What is the most critical engineering factor for a long-lasting fence in De Peyster?
Frost line depth of 48 inches controls footing stability. Posts in De Peyster Center must be set below this line per IRC standards. Shallow footings will heave upward during winter thaws, causing permanent structural failure and panel racking.

How does the local wind load rating affect fence design?
A V-ult wind speed of 115 MPH dictates structural design. This engineering rating requires reduced post spacing, concrete footings sized for overturning moment, and wind-rated brackets. This ensures the fence can survive peak storm season gusts, especially in open areas near NY-37.
What fencing materials are best for De Peyster's soil and pest conditions?
A moderate soil corrosivity index requires hot-dip galvanized steel posts and fasteners to prevent rust streaks. Given the moderate termite risk, pressure-treated wood must be rated for ground contact. Material compatibility between posts, fasteners, and panels prevents galvanic corrosion.
